Where to Use It Carefully
While Life is Better with My Dog SVG is versatile, there are a few situations where extra care should be taken. On textured fabrics or thin materials, the stitch density may need adjusting to avoid puckering. Similarly, when working with dark fabric, selecting high-contrast thread colors is essential to maintain visibility.
Curved surfaces like caps or hats can also pose a challenge. The design needs to be adapted carefully to follow the curve without losing clarity. Additionally, if you're planning to use it on layered garments or products that will undergo frequent washing, testing the durability of the stitching is a must.

Embroidery Designer Notes
If you’re considering using Life is Better with My Dog SVG in your next project, here are a few practical tips:
- Test it first: Always run a test on scrap fabric to check stitch clarity and fabric compatibility.
- Check thread contrast: Ensure the chosen thread colors provide good visibility on your intended fabric background.
- Review stitch density: Adjust as needed for different fabric types and hoop sizes.
- Use proper stabilizer: Especially important for stretchy or thin materials.
- Confirm licensing: Before selling finished items or digital products, verify the license terms.
